基于SSM框架的在线房屋租赁系统开发

版权申诉
0 下载量 14 浏览量 更新于2024-10-10 收藏 24.74MB ZIP 举报
资源摘要信息:"243房屋租赁系统.zip" 标题分析: "243房屋租赁系统.zip" 这个标题暗示了一个专门为房屋租赁行业设计的系统,其中"SSM"可能指的是Spring, SpringMVC和MyBatis这一组合的Java企业级开发框架,它在Java Web项目中被广泛使用,因为其易于配置和维护的特性。 描述分析: 描述中提到的功能包括管理员、会员和前台首页的管理功能,以及系统对互联网特点的良好适应性。特别强调了基于互联网的特点,比如简化了信息流程,方便用户利用碎片化时间浏览和租赁房屋。此外,文章还提到了房屋租赁系统开发的全过程,从需求分析、总体设计到具体实现,这是一个典型的软件开发项目过程。 标签分析: "毕业设计" 这个标签表明该文件可能是一个学生的毕业设计项目文档,可能包含了需求分析、系统设计、数据库设计、功能实现以及使用说明等部分。 压缩包子文件的文件名称列表分析: - "ssm-房屋租赁系统lw+ppt.rar" 可能包含了房屋租赁系统的源代码、开发文档和演示文稿。 - "项目部署说明.zip" 可能是关于如何部署这个房屋租赁系统的具体步骤和指南。 - "ssml53w4" 这个文件名不完整,难以确定其具体内容,但推测可能是与项目相关的其他文档或代码。 知识点详细说明: 1. 房屋租赁系统功能模块 - 管理员模块:提供了管理员登录系统的接口,以及管理房屋类型、租赁信息、会员信息、订单信息、合同信息、退房评价和系统其他后台管理的职能。 - 会员模块:会员可以通过这个模块浏览房屋租赁信息,管理自己的订单和合同,并进行退房评价。 - 前台首页:提供了用户访问系统的入口,展示房屋租赁信息和公告信息,同时会员可以在个人中心进行管理。 2. SSM框架的应用 - Spring:提供了企业级应用开发的基础设施支持,管理业务对象的生命周期,以及事务管理等。 - SpringMVC:负责处理用户的请求和响应,提供了一个模型视图控制器的实现。 - MyBatis:简化了Java应用的数据库编程,管理数据访问层的代码,减少SQL语句和Java代码的耦合。 3. 系统开发过程 - 需求分析:明确了系统需要实现哪些功能,目标用户的需求以及系统的运行环境。 - 总体设计:规划了系统的整体架构,包括系统模块划分、技术选型和数据库设计。 - 具体实现:根据设计文档编写了系统源代码,并通过单元测试和集成测试确保功能正确实现。 - 部署与使用:编写了部署说明文档,指导用户如何安装和运行系统,同时制作了演示文稿来展示系统功能。 4. 技术与创新点 - 简单的接口:提供了易于使用的API,便于前后端分离和跨平台使用。 - 方便的应用:用户可以通过任何支持互联网的设备访问系统。 - 强大的互动:系统设计了互动功能,如会员可以评价房屋,增强了用户体验。 - 基于互联网:系统充分利用了互联网的优势,提高了租赁效率,适应了现代社会快节奏的生活方式。 该文件中所涉及的技术和知识点,为房屋租赁行业提供了一套完整的解决方案,不仅包括系统功能的实现,还包含了系统的开发过程和部署说明,对于即将开发类似系统的学习者和开发者具有很高的参考价值。